News

Specialization: Data Science Foundations: Data Structures and Algorithms Instructor: Sriram Sankaranarayanan, Assistant Professor Prior knowledge needed: Mathematical Background: We expect that the ...
A notebook illustrating value iteration algorithm. In addition. the notebook also covers some background of dynamic programming, briefly discussing for example Markov Decision Processes, policies and ...
Learn how to explain dynamic programming to a beginner in algorithms using simple examples and tips. Discover the trade-offs and challenges of this technique. Skip to main content LinkedIn ...
In this paper, we describe usability of programming languages and tools in the development of complex algorithms on the example of critical path algorithm in project network optimisation. We discuss ...
And through practical examples, the algorithm is easy to be understood. In the experiments, the dimension of the problem and the value of k are changed so as to study the relationship between the ...
Introduction to programming, data structures, and algorithm design, using one or more modern imperative language9s), as chosen by the instructor. Students will learn: basic programming constructs, ...
Specialization: Data Science Foundations: Data Structures and Algorithms Instructor: Sriram Sankaranarayanan, Assistant Professor Prior knowledge needed: We highly recommended successfully completing ...
The prerequisite is an undergraduate algorithms class. Here is some relevant information: The course outline. Animations for various parallel algorithms. We will cover many of these algorithms in the ...